Flow Lab is a low-code/no-code platform focused on automating workflows and business processes. It allows users to quickly build workflows, connect to data sources, and deploy automated solutions without writing code.
Calm is a meditation and mindfulness app that provides users with guided meditations, sleep stories, breathing programs, and relaxing music. The app has over 100 guided meditations for stress, anxiety, focus, sleep, and more.
